The Box Magazine Description:
The Box Magazine serves the vast — and growing — population of CrossFitters. It educates new practitioners about CrossFit’s benefits, motivates existing members of the CrossFit community and advocates for the sport of CrossFit.
EDUCATE
From training to nutrition, we aim to offer tools all readers can use to improve their CrossFit experience, including illustrating proper form on classic CrossFit exercises, from burpees to thrusters; explaining the importance of grip strength — and then instructing how to increase it; and outlining the health- and performance-boosting effects of various critical nutrients.
MOTIVATE
By including a Workout of the Month in every issue — and then encouraging readers to post their scores online — offering advanced training regimens for CF experts and reviews of necessary training gear, we keep even highly experienced CrossFit athletes working hard to improve their scores.
ADVOCATE
